AN-HTTPDで、exeをCGIとして起動させる設定方法は?

[上に] [前に] [次に]
小林健吾 2000/01/19(水) 15:08:36

#include <stdio.h>
void main(void)
{
printf("Content-type: text/plain\n\n");
printf("Hello, world!\n");
exit();
}

というexeを作って、DOS窓では動作を確認していますが、
http://localhost/hello.exe でCGIとして起動できません。
AN-HTTPDは常に最新版を使っています。
お願いいたします。

andi 2000/01/19(水) 15:12:25
一般オプションのexeCGIを起動をチェックして、
ファイルの.exeを.cgiに変更したら動きました。

小林健吾 2000/01/19(水) 15:37:20
先ほど最新版のv1.24をダウンロードし、
Options→General→Generalと移動しましたが、
exeCGIという項目がありません。
拡張子を変えても、どうしてもダウンロードになってしまいます。

aqua-J 2000/01/19(水) 15:51:49
英語モードでしょうか?
Generalに「check .cgi IF EXE/Script」という項目があると思いますが
ちなみに、Appearance/Indexで、英語と日本語の切り替えはできます。

小林健吾 2000/01/19(水) 16:07:45
[[解決]]
できました。
httpdの設定ではなく、IE5.0が text/plainを理解できなかっただけでした。
text/htmlににしたらOKでした。
ありがとうございました。

hiro-kim 2000/01/19(水) 17:00:27
ホントだ……拡張子が.txtであってもファイルの中身がHTMLタグだとそのタグを解釈して表示しますね,IE5.0。IE5.01でもそうなのかな。

[上に] [前に] [次に]